A Security Risk Advisory Specialist or Consultant is responsible for identifying, assessing and mitigating security risks to help clients to protect their organization’s assets, people and information.
Client Advisory and Service Delivery
- Act as a trusted advisor to clients, understanding their business objectives and aligning security strategies
- Lead monthly or quarterly security risk reviews
- Translate complex security findings into clear, actionable recommendations relevant to client’s business context
- Ensure timely delivery of all contractual security advisory deliverables
Security Assessment and Monitoring
- Conduct comprehensive cybersecurity assessment to provide the client’s current security posture based on available data or information
- Collaborate with SOC teams to analyze security events and incidents identified through
- Generate executive level reporting that demonstrates the value of our service
Service Improvement
- Contribute to the continuous improvement of service offerings and delivery process
- Develop standardized templates and methodologies for security reviews
- Stay current on emerging cybersecurity threats, technologies and compliance
requirements
- Support client onboarding and ensure smooth transition to operational teams Technical Leadership
- Provide expert guidance on cybersecurity technologies selection and implementation
- Help align security programs with industry frameworks (NIST, ISO27001, CIS)
- Assist with security architecture reviews and improvement recommendations
- Support security incident response when significant events occur

skills and experience required
- 5+ years of cybersecurity experience with at least 2 years in a consultative or advisory role
- Experience in an MSSP or security service delivery environment
- Demonstrated ability to translate technical security concepts into business value
- Strong technical knowledge of security frameworks, risk management tools, and compliance regulations
- Excellence in client facing communication and executive presentation
- Analytical skills to assess complex security data and develop actionable insights
- Project management capabilities to manage multiple client engagements simultaneously
- Service delivery mindset with focus on client satisfaction and value demonstration
